Cost
It's one of the most frustrating things that could occur to anyone. Nearly everyone has lost their keys at one time or another in their lives. This is particularly true for those who use their vehicle for work or school regularly, as well as for those who have children.
It's now easier than ever before to replace keys lost. Now, you can order new ones at a dealership or from a locksmith in your area.
The cost of purchasing a new Audi key varies based on the year of manufacture and type. Typically keys with a key fob or remote key will cost between $280 and $450. The dealer may also charge an amount for programming in order to have your new key synchronized to your vehicle.
Before you purchase your key, it's recommended to ask the dealer or locksmith for VIN numbers. This will assure you that you are purchasing an authentic Audi key.
The majority of locksmiths can cut a key without the VIN however only a professional can create an entirely new key for you. The reason for this is that these keys contain a chip which needs to be read and programmed by your car's ECU.
Automotive locksmiths have tools and equipment that facilitate this process and make it quick and easy. They can complete the task at their location, in their shop or even in your driveway.
They typically provide 24 hour service, which means they are able to assist you if you're in need of assistance in a rush. They will also travel to your location in case of need.
Many locksmiths will also cut and program your key to unlock your doors in the event that you have lost your original keys. This is a great solution if you are always locked out of your car and you are unable to unlock it on your own.
If you're concerned about the expense of the cost of an Audi key replacement, be sure to compare prices at multiple dealerships in your region prior to making a final decision. The cost of replacement can be very different between dealers so it is crucial to compare them to determine the most affordable price for replacing your key.
